The Power And Precision Of AMC Servo Drives

When it comes to controlling the motion and speed of various industrial applications, servo drives play a crucial role These electronic amplifiers are designed to power servo motors and provide precise control over position, velocity, and torque Among the top manufacturers of high-performance servo drives is Advanced Motion Controls, more commonly known as AMC With a reputation for innovation and reliability, AMC servo drives are trusted by industries worldwide for their exceptional quality and performance.

AMC servo drives are known for their versatility, making them suitable for a wide range of applications across industries such as robotics, automation, aerospace, and more Whether you need to control the movements of a robotic arm with utmost precision or ensure the smooth operation of a conveyor belt system, AMC servo drives offer the power and flexibility needed to meet your requirements.

One of the key features that sets AMC servo drives apart from the competition is their advanced control algorithms These drives are equipped with sophisticated feedback mechanisms that allow for precise monitoring and adjustment of motor performance This level of control ensures smooth and accurate motion, even in the most demanding industrial environments.

Another standout feature of AMC servo drives is their high power density Despite their compact size, these drives are capable of delivering high levels of torque and speed to meet the demands of a wide range of applications This makes them ideal for use in space-constrained installations where efficiency and performance are critical.

AMC servo drives are also easy to integrate into existing systems, thanks to their compatibility with a variety of communication interfaces such as EtherCAT, CANopen, and RS-232 This allows for seamless connectivity with other control devices and ensures smooth operation within a larger automation setup Additionally, AMC offers comprehensive software tools that simplify the configuration and tuning of servo drives, making it easy to optimize performance for specific applications.

The versatility of AMC servo drives extends to their adaptability to different motor types, including brushless DC, brushed DC, and stepper motors This flexibility allows for seamless integration with a wide range of motor configurations, giving users the freedom to choose the most suitable option for their specific needs Whether you require high-speed performance or precise position control, AMC servo drives can be tailored to meet your exact requirements.
